Renovation of the Nzolana road: A project supported by Sicomines to open up the commune of Ngaliema
The Sino-Congolese program continues to support infrastructure development in the Democratic Republic of Congo. The renovation of the Nzolana road, financed by Sicomines, is a perfect example of this fruitful collaboration. This project, which is part of the Sino-Congolese program, aims to open up the commune of Ngaliema, by connecting several important neighborhoods such as Kimbwala, Malweka, Sanga-Mamba and Bumba.
The inspection visit carried out by the Minister of State for Infrastructure and Public Works confirmed the progress of work on the second phase of renovation of the Nzolana road. Accompanied by various officials, including the general director of the major works agency (ACGT) and the general director of the Sino-Congolese infrastructure company (SISC), the minister expressed his satisfaction with the progress of the project.
The work includes asphalt coating, cement concrete coating and sanitation work. Particular attention is also paid to the quality of the project, with close cooperation between ACGT and SISC to ensure orderly implementation in all aspects.
Once completed, the renovation of the Nzolana road will allow a significant improvement in travel conditions for local residents. It will also contribute to promoting the economic development of the region, by promoting the well-being and development of the local population.
